1: Embrace Emotional Expression

One of the first steps in coping with grief is acknowledging and embracing the multitude of emotions that come with loss. It’s essential to give oneself permission to feel and express these emotions without judgment. Whether it’s sadness, anger, guilt, or a complex mix of feelings, allowing them to surface is crucial to the healing process.

Healthy outlets for emotional expression can include talking to friends, family, or a therapist. Verbalizing thoughts and emotions can provide relief and create a supportive space for processing grief. Additionally, engaging in creative expressions like journaling, art, or other forms of self-expression can be therapeutic. These outlets allow individuals to externalize their emotions, making it easier to navigate the healing journey.

 

2: Build a Support System

No one should navigate grief alone. Building a strong support system is paramount to coping effectively with loss. Friends, family, and support groups provide comfort and understanding during challenging times. Surrounding oneself with a network of supportive individuals creates a safe space to share feelings and memories.

Open communication is key within a support system. Encouraging dialogue about the departed loved one and expressing one’s emotions fosters a sense of connection and understanding. Seeking professional help, such as grief counseling or therapy, is also valid and valuable. Professionals can provide guidance and tools to navigate the complexities of grief, ensuring individuals receive the support they need.

 

3: Establish Rituals and Memorialize

Creating rituals or traditions to honor the memory of a loved one can be a powerful way to find solace in the grieving process. These rituals can be as simple as lighting a candle every year on the anniversary of their passing or as elaborate as organizing a memorial event. The act of commemorating a loved one helps keep their memory alive and fosters a sense of connection.

Activities like creating a scrapbook, planting a memorial tree, or dedicating a special space in the home can be therapeutic. Engaging in these acts of memorialization provides a tangible way to express love and respect for the departed. Positive remembrance, focusing on the joyous moments shared, contributes to the healing process by emphasizing the positive impact the loved one had on one’s life.

4: Hypnosis as a Complementary Healing Tool

In recent years, hypnosis has emerged as a complementary therapy for managing grief. While not a standalone solution, hypnosis can offer additional support in the grieving process. This therapeutic technique induces deep relaxation, enabling individuals to access and process subconscious emotions.

Benefits of hypnosis for grief management include stress reduction, enhanced relaxation, and the potential to uncover and address unresolved emotions. Approach hypnosis with caution and engage the guidance of a qualified hypnotist. Seeking professional help ensures personalized sessions tailored to the griever’s needs and circumstances.
